== TMSi ==

[[File: Tmsi_mobita.jpg]]

=== Mobita ===

'''Setup'''
* Mobita with trigger-header (MobA##et), connected to trigger interface (midi-buttonbox) via iso-trigger module.
* Trigger interface MDI IN connected to MIDI OUT on iRig2 device (midi controller)
* iRig2 device connected to main machine USB.
* Windows machine with both ethernet and wifi (use dongle and shut down regular wifi!)
* Buffer_BCI software
* TMSi Fieldtrip Polybench
* Main machine with ethernet
* Matlab
* Brainstream



'''Start-up'''
* Connect Mobita with header.
''Blue light on Mobita should start flashing.''
* On Windows machine, setup WiFi dongle connection with mobita. Password is MOBITAxxxxxxx, where the x-es are the last seven numbers of the mobita.
''Windows should say 'Connected' or 'Verbonden'.''
* On Windows machine, double-click downloads/buffer_bci/buffer_bci/dataAcq/startBuffer
''Command window with buffer should pop-up.''
* On Windows machine, start Polybench (TSMi to Fieldtrip). In Polybench, set ‘Front-end categ’ to ‘WiFi front-ends’ and check sample frequency, then press ‘Start’.
''Buffer should start running data, Polybench should show data of first four channels.''
* On main machine, start a Matlab session, then run the code snippet below. Make sure the src variable is set according to the Windows machine’s IP address (IPv4-address).
''Matlab should start running data.''<br />

cd ~/bci_code/toolboxes/brainstream/core/
bs_addpath;
% verify src ip-address of Windows machine to find the xxx numbers!
src = 'buffer://131.174.xxx.xxx:1972';
dst = 'buffer://localhost:1973';
trigger = [];
trigger.fun = 'get_tmsi_mobita_triggers';
trigger.cfg.channel = 36; % check number of channels of header!
ft2ft(src,dst,trigger);<br />

* The variable ‘dst’ specifies the location at which the buffer can be found, i.e., where to find the data for the main applitcation (e.g., BrainStream project).

'''View data'''
* Start a Matlab session, and run the lines below, where the variable src is set according to the ‘FieldTrip server IP’ in Polybench.
cd ~/bci_code/toolboxes/brainstream/core/
bs_addpath;
% with default preprocessing
src = 'buffer://localhost:1973:tmsi_mobita|rjv_basic_preproc_biosemi_active2';
% without preprocessing
src = 'buffer://localhost:1973:tmsi_mobita|rjv_basic_preproc_biosemi_active2';
start_viewer(src,'eeg','eeglab.blk')

'''Notes'''
* Mobita_0710130019 works with header 0730140005.
* Mobita works with only one trigger input, only at event/marker value 1.
* Trigger pulse can be viewed using quick_buffer_viewer_raw at brainstream/resources/start_scripts or StartBufferViewer at buffer_bci/dataAcq
